Community Pharmacists raise concern over govt’s plan for new regulations for healthcare facilities

The Association of Community Pharmacists of Nigeria, ACPN, has expressed concerns over the Federal Government’s plan to introduce new regulations for healthcare facilities in Nigeria. ACPN claimed the proposed reforms are unnecessary and could be counterproductive. In a statement issued by its Chairman and Secretary, Ambrose Eze and Omokhafe Ashore respectively, ACPN said the existing National Health Act of 2014, if fully implemented, could effectively address the problem of unregulated and substandard healthcare facilities. Kidnapping ranks as Nigeria’s most-reported crime case under Tinubu

Kidnapping for ransom has ranked as Nigeria’s most-reported crime case under President Bola Ahmed Tinubu’s administration. StatiSense, quoting 2023 data from Nigeria’s Ministry of Police Affairs, disclosed this on Thursday through its X account. According to the data, kidnapping cases have outperformed murder, banditry, terrorism, and armed robbery in terms of reports in Nigeria. In a zonal analysis, kidnapping crimes are ranked as the most reported in the North Central (38.51 percent), North East (42.11 percent),…
